Lake Trail

Nearby Town: Springfield, Illinois
Ride Type: Loop
Trail Type: Single Track 95%
Dual Track 5%
Distance: 6.00 miles (9.65 KM)
Duration: not specified.
Elevation Gain: not specified.
Climbing: Rolling Terrain
Skill Level: Something for everyone
User Density: not specified.



Trail Description:
Nice rolling single-track with a fair amount of easy to moderate obsticles. A bit

muddy and buggy in the summertime due to the close proximity of Lake Springfield.

Easily the best riding within an hour's drive.

How to get there:
South from Springfield on the new Interurban trail to Woodbine Road. From there,

south on the old railroad access road (enter just east of Pedigro's Nursery). The

first trail head will come up on your right in less than a mile.
